5. Ravenous Devils

Starting off our list with a rather unique entry, we have Ravenous Devils. This game is a cooking game. But with a distinct horror-inspired style that makes it truly stand out among games in the same vein. Set in Victorian London, this game has a backdrop that has become rather famous for its use in horror-related media. For players who are themselves musical fanatics, you might recognize this game's gameplay loop as being inspired by Sweeney Todd. This makes the game stand out even more because there are few games that use a horror cooking foundation, much fewer ones with musical references.

Players are able to control both of the game's main characters but in a unique way. The layout of the game is split into two levels of the building in which the characters work. Additionally, players are able to control one character at a time. This is because they provide the other with either foods or bodies to be made into food. This gruesome gameplay loop becomes rather fun the more you get into the game. All in all, if you are looking for cooking games on PlayStation 4 or PlayStation 5, that are just a bit different. Definitely check this one out.

4. Chef Life: A Restaurant Simulator

For those who are not only interested in the culinary aspects but the business side of different cuisines. We have Chef Life: A Restaurant Simulator. This game is unique in quite a few ways, including its approach to gameplay and the number of things you have control over. The player is tasked with the goal of earning a Michelin star for their restaurant. Players are able to customize a ton of elements of their kitchens and much more. This makes the game feel more real and gives a teaching element to the game as well.

The recipes, ingredients, and many other things featured in this game are all fantastic and allow the players to feel like complete chefs. Players are able to control the cooking process at a number of stages. These include mixing your own ingredients, chopping, and many other tasks that typically occur in the kitchen. This is great as it allows the player to feel accomplished in completing recipes to perfection. So if you are looking for cooking games with a more realistic take on the PlayStation 4 or PlayStation 5, this is a great choice.

3. Brewmaster: Beer Brewing Simulator

Now for a more adult cooking game or rather brewing game, we have Brewmaster; Beer Brewing Simulator. In this game, players are able to homebrew their own brews using a variety of techniques and ingredients. The equipment that players will be able to use is also rather realistic. Players have control of a ton of elements of their brew, such as content, even down to the label being placed on the bottles. This gives the player an astounding amount of agency, which is great.

While it may appear to be somewhat of a niche title, this beer-brewing game is filled to the rim with fun things to do. So if you are a beer enthusiast or simply enjoy cooking games for the PlayStation 4 or PlayStation 5, this is a great game to play. With an emphasis being placed on the learning of these recipes, players will be able to learn while they are playing, all in a way that is fun and innovative. So if you haven't checked out Brewmaster: Beer Brewing Simulator. Now is a great time to do so.

2. Make the Burger

While it may be a comparatively smaller entry on this list, we have Make the Burger. If you are looking for a classic cooking experience that few games can replicate, definitely check out this title. Players are able to feed a hungry community that is down on its luck, which gives this game a touching backdrop. Much like other cooking games, players will be responsible for remembering orders and the ingredients to foods, as well as other elements of the cooking process.

This is where the game's time limits come into play. Players will have to craft the perfect burgers in a short period of time in order to make the customers the happiest they can be. Players will even be able to unlock higher-quality ingredients, as well as more restaurant layouts and equipment throughout the game. This makes it a great game to jump into cooking games for the PlayStation 4 and PlayStation 5. With a rather cheap price tag of around 4 USD, players cannot afford to miss this fantastic cooking game.

1. Overcooked! All You Can Eat EditionSeptember

First of all, both Overcooked! and Overcooked! 2 are a blast now if you couple that with the fact that they are all made available in one package through Overcooked! All You Can Eat Edition, and you have a winning recipe for success. These games are some of the most multiplayer fun you can have on both the PlayStation 4 and PlayStation 5, although rounds can get hectic and heated at times.

The genius of these games is held within their simple premise. Players will have to contend with their kitchens and serve hungry customers. All while dealing with the ever-changing level of design. This throws an element of surprise into the game, as players must learn to coordinate with one another in order to succeed. However, this is easier said than done, as you will have to do this quickly. In conclusion, Overcooked! All You Can Eat Edition is the definitive way to enjoy these culinary games at their peak, so if you are looking into cooking games on PlayStation. You will be hard-pressed to find a better value than this.
